Rio Tinto to supply gold for Wal-Mart
Wednesday, 16th July 2008 (953 views)
The Rio Tinto mining company has announced it will be providing gold for Wal-Mart's jewellery collection called Love, Earth.
Using gold from Rio Tinto's mine in Utah, Wal-Mart will sell the jewellery both in-store, in Sam's Club and on both of the companies' websites.
Wal-Mart's decision to start selling traceable gold jewellery was announced earlier this week.
A deal was created between Conservation International and the department store which will enable customers to find out exactly where their jewellery comes from.
Pam Mortensen, vice president and divisional merchandise manager for Wal-Mart, said: "As the largest retailer of jewellery in the world, Wal-Mart is in a unique position to influence sustainable practices in the jewellery industry."
In addition, the Newmont Mining Corporation also revealed it would be supplying the Love, Earth collection with gold from its mines.
Customers will be able to log on online and find out about the environmental programmes of each of the suppliers.
